非常风气网www.verywind.cn
首页
用循环求n的阶乘c语言编程
C语言
计算1到10
的阶乘
的和的代码是什么
答:
C语言
计算1到10
的阶乘
的和的代码如下:#include"stdio.h"#include"math.h"voidmain(){inti,j,n,sum=0;for(i=1;i<=10;i++){ n=1;for(j=1;j<=i;j++)n*=j;/* 将每一项阶乘相加求和。*/ sum+=n;} printf("%d\n",sum);} 本
程序采用
两层
循环
...
用c语言
for
循环求
1到10
阶乘
答:
void main()主函数 { int i,a=1;定义整形变量i,a(a初值为1)int sum =0;定义整形变量sum 初值为0 for(i = 1;i<=10;i++)设i的值为1,当i小于等于10成立时跳出答案,不成立,i的数值加1 { a = a i;a=a乘以i sum = sum + a;sum记录求和 } printf("1到10
的阶乘
和是 d",...
C语言
中
阶乘
怎么输?
答:
就是从 1 开始乘以比前一个数大 1 的数,一直乘到
n
。
C语言
中可
利用循环
解决,可以假设循环变量为 i,初值为 1,i 从 1 变化到 n;依次让 i 与 sum 相乘,并将乘积赋给 sum,最后输出sum的值就可以了:3、在编辑器中运行
程序
,随意输入一个数,按下回车键,即可打印出
阶乘
的结果来:...
C语言编写
一个
求n阶乘的
函数,在主函数中输入n,调用函数求n阶乘。。谢...
答:
//因
C语言
数据类型限制,不能做大数
的阶乘
运算 //
n的
值超过22结果会不准确 include <stdio.h> double jc( int n ){ int i;double rs=1 ;for( i=1;i<=n;i++ )rs *= i ;return rs ;} int main(){ int n;printf("input n:");scanf("%d" , &n );printf("%d!=%.0lf\n...
C语言
如何计算1到10
的阶乘
的和?
答:
C语言
计算1到10
的阶乘
的和的代码如下:#include"stdio.h"#include"math.h"voidmain(){inti,j,n,sum=0;for(i=1;i<=10;i++){ n=1;for(j=1;j<=i;j++)n*=j;/* 将每一项阶乘相加求和。*/ sum+=n;} printf("%d\n",sum);} 本
程序采用
两层
循环
...
c语言
怎么用递归调用函数的方法
求n的阶乘
?
答:
1、打开VC6.0软件,新建一个C语言的项目:2、接下来
编写
主
程序
,首先定义用来
求阶乘的
递归函数以及主函数。在main函数里定义变量sum求和,调用递归函数fact(),并将返回值赋予sum,最后使用printf打印sum的结果,主程序就编写完了:3、最后运行程序,观察输出的结果。以上就是
C语言使用
递归求阶乘的写法:...
用C语言
编一个
程序
答:
int result = 0 ; /*用来存储若干阶乘的和 初始化为0*/ for(;i<=10;i++) /*
循环
10次以计算1-10阶乘的和*/ { result+=getResult(i); /*把 i! 加到累加器中*/ } printf("1-10阶乘和为: %d", result);getch();} 2.从1到
n的阶乘
的和的
程序
include<conio.h> include<stdio....
急!!!
C语言阶乘
问题 求一到一百
的阶乘
和 用While或While do
循环
语句或...
答:
include<
c
stdio>#include<cstring>#include<iostream>#include<algorithm>using namespace std;const int MAX
N
=510;char re[MAXN];struct Big{int s[MAXN],len;Big():len(1){memset(s,0,sizeof(s));}void read(){scanf("%s",re);int
n
=strlen(re);len=(n-1)/4+1;int x=len,k=...
分别输出1-10
的阶乘
,
用循环
做,
c语言
的题,怎么写呢。。。
答:
include <stdio.h> int main(){ double a,b,
c
;c=1;while(c<=10){ a=1;b=1;while(b<=c){ a=a*b;b++;} printf("%0.0lf!=%0.0lf\
n
",b-1,a);c++;} return 0;}
100
的阶乘
在
C语言
中怎么
编程
(要求用while和for两种方法)?
答:
include <stdio.h>int main(){ int a=100; double num=1.0;//while
循环
相乘实现阶乘while(a>0){ num *= a; a--;}printf("100!的结果:%le\n",num);//for循环相乘实现
阶乘n
um=1;for(a=1;a<=100;a++){ num *= a;}printf("100!的结果:%le\n",num);return...
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网